Ranjith Kumar Manoharan is a scholar working on Computer Vision and Pattern Recognition, Molecular Biology and Artificial Intelligence. According to data from OpenAlex, Ranjith Kumar Manoharan has authored 53 papers receiving a total of 937 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Computer Vision and Pattern Recognition, 10 papers in Molecular Biology and 10 papers in Artificial Intelligence. Recurrent topics in Ranjith Kumar Manoharan's work include Chaos-based Image/Signal Encryption (11 papers), Coding theory and cryptography (5 papers) and Bacterial biofilms and quorum sensing (5 papers). Ranjith Kumar Manoharan is often cited by papers focused on Chaos-based Image/Signal Encryption (11 papers), Coding theory and cryptography (5 papers) and Bacterial biofilms and quorum sensing (5 papers). Ranjith Kumar Manoharan collaborates with scholars based in India, South Korea and Saudi Arabia. Ranjith Kumar Manoharan's co-authors include Young‐Ho Ahn, Jin‐Hyung Lee, Yong‐Guy Kim, Jintae Lee, S. Neelakandan, Sam Soo Kim, Jaewoong Lee, Balasubramanian Rukmanikrishnan, Jintae Lee and Ill–Sup Nou and has published in prestigious journals such as Bioresource Technology, Chemical Engineering Journal and Chemosphere.
